Where to Use "I D Smoke That" Carefully

While "I D Smoke That" is versatile, there are some areas where caution is advised. Small chest placements may require adjusting the design scale to avoid looking cramped. Dense stitch areas could be an issue on stretchy fabrics like fleece or ribbed materials, so testing on scrap fabric is essential.

Curved surfaces and tiny lettering may also pose challenges. If you're planning to use this on a hoodie back design or a curved area of a sweatshirt, ensure the hoop size allows for proper stabilization. Checking the stitch density before production can prevent puckering or distortion on delicate fabrics.

Embroidery Designer Notes: Key Considerations

Before committing to a large batch of sweatshirt embroidery or hoodie design projects, I recommend testing "I D Smoke That" on scrap fabric. This will help you assess how the design interacts with different fabric textures and ensure the stabilizer choice supports the stitch density.

Reviewing thread color contrast is another important step. Depending on the fabric you’re using, you may need to adjust the color palette to maintain visibility and visual impact. Confirming the hoop size and checking the Creative Fabrica product details for any limitations will also help streamline your workflow.
